Hypertension is the most typical preventable trigger of cardiovascular illness. Home blood stress monitoring (HBPM) is a self-monitoring tool that can be incorporated into the care for patients with hypertension and is beneficial by major tips. A growing body of proof supports the benefits of affected person HBPM in contrast with workplace-primarily based monitoring: blood oxygen monitor these include improved control of BP, diagnosis of white-coat hypertension and prediction of cardiovascular danger. Furthermore, HBPM is cheaper and easier to carry out than 24-hour ambulatory BP monitoring (ABPM). All HBPM devices require validation, however, as inaccurate readings have been present in a high proportion of screens. New know-how options a longer inflatable area within the cuff that wraps all the best way round the arm, increasing the ‘acceptable range’ of placement and thus reducing the impact of cuff placement on studying accuracy, thereby overcoming the limitations of current gadgets.

Office BP measurement is associated with a number of disadvantages. A study during which repeated BP measurements were made over a 2-week period under analysis research conditions discovered variations of as much as 30 mmHg with no therapy adjustments. A latest observational examine required major care physicians (PCPs) to measure BP on 10 volunteers. Two skilled research assistants repeated the measures immediately after the PCPs.
